Performance
The A16 chip with 6GB of RAM isn’t going to win any benchmark shootouts, landing around the 55th percentile for CPU and 56th for GPU in our tablet database. That sounds mediocre, but it’s all you need for the iPad’s intended life. Apps open instantly, Split View multitasking is smooth, and casual games play without a stutter. The real standout is the 29Wh battery, which we rank 96th percentile, so you’ll get a solid workday of video and web browsing no problem. Just don’t expect to edit 4K video with a dozen layers.

vs Competition
Stack it against the Samsung Galaxy Tab S9 FE+, and the iPad loses on screen smoothness (the Samsung packs a 90Hz panel) and ships with the S Pen in the box, while the Apple Pencil is a separate purchase. The Xiaomi Pad 7 Pro pushes even further with a 144Hz display and faster charging for similar money. But Apple's tablet OS and app store remain cleaner and more polished, so if you just want a reliable slate for casual use, the iPad A16 is still the one to beat. If you need a laptop stand-in, the Surface Pro 11th Edition is in a different league with full Windows, but it costs a whole lot more. And if you're shopping at the high end, the new iPad Pro M5 and Samsung Galaxy Tab S11 Ultra are in another universe entirely, both in performance and price.

Value & Pricing
The price spread on this thing is wild, ranging from about $299 for a renewed unit on Amazon up to $518 at some retailers. At the lower end, it’s an absolute steal for a tablet this good. That renewed deal in particular is tough to beat if you don’t mind a refurb. Once you creep toward $500, though, you’re flirting with iPad Air territory, and that extra cash buys you an M-series chip, a better display, and more RAM. Shop smart, and this iPad becomes a value champion.

Overview
Apple’s 2025 iPad with the A16 chip is basically the old faithful of tablets, and it’s still got some fight left. You get an 11-inch Liquid Retina display, the same processor that powered the iPhone 14 Pro, and a battery that just refuses to die. It’s clearly built for reading, streaming, and doomscrolling, and at that, it’s still one of the best around. But don’t expect it to replace your laptop, productivity is not its strong suit.
We poked around our database and the numbers tell a clear story. Battery life sits in the 96th percentile, meaning it’s top-tier and will easily outlast your attention span. The screen is bright and sharp, but stuck at 60Hz. That’s fine for most people who don’t know what they’re missing, but it feels a little stingy when cheaper tablets have moved on. Still, the 4.9-star average from over 80,000 owners suggests most folks are pretty happy.
Common Questions
Q: Does the 60Hz screen really matter if I only use it for reading and streaming?
Honestly, for reading and video, no, it doesn’t. The refresh rate only stands out when you’re scrolling fast or using a smoother display side-by-side. Most people won’t care.
Q: Is the 128GB storage enough?
It’s fine if you mostly stream and use cloud services, but downloaded movies, games, and apps can eat it up fast. If you plan to load up offline content, hunt down the 256GB version or invest in iCloud.
Q: Can I use a keyboard and mouse with it for light work?
Yes, the Smart Connector supports Apple’s keyboard cover, and Bluetooth keyboards and mice work too. Just don’t expect a full desktop experience, iPadOS multitasking still feels cramped for serious productivity.
